The Language of Mathematics

First and foremost, to improve in mathematics, it is essential to understand the language of the subject. This involves more than just memorizing formulas; it requires a deep comprehension of the underlying principles and how they relate to real-world problems.

One effective way to clear up any misunderstandings and develop a better grasp of mathematical concepts is to solve a wide variety of problems. By actively engaging with math problems, you can remove your fear and build confidence in your abilities. Regular practice will help you develop a more intuitive understanding of the subject, making complex topics more manageable.

The Power of Practice

The most effective strategy for improving math skills is consistent problem-solving. Practice is the key to mastery. When you encounter a difficult problem, don't be discouraged. Instead, view it as an opportunity to learn and grow. Sometimes, you might need to struggle for a while before finding the solution, but it is these efforts that lead to real understanding and improvement.

Khan Academy is a valuable resource for those seeking additional support or reinforcement. Created by Salman Khan, this platform offers thousands of video lessons, interactive exercises, and personalized learning dashboards to help students at all levels. While the videos are beneficial, the practice problems are often the most effective for developing problem-solving skills.

Taking Action in School

For students in the American public school system, ensure that you are meeting the basic requirements for your math course. Homework completion and regular practice are crucial, even if the homework is graded on accuracy. Completing assignments, even if you make mistakes, will give you the opportunity to learn from your errors and improve your understanding.

Some students wonder if their teachers are providing valuable instruction. While it is important to attend class, consider supplementing your learning with self-study. Utilize online resources, such as video tutorials and textbooks, to gain a deeper understanding of the subject matter.
